/* search.c
Free software by Richard W.E. Furse. Do with as you will. No
warranty. */
/* patched by Jarno Seppnen, jams@cs.tut.fi, for plugin~ */
/*****************************************************************************/
#include <dirent.h>
#include <dlfcn.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<unistd.h>
/*****************************************************************************/
#include "ladspa.h"
#include "jutils.h"
/*****************************************************************************/
/* Search just the one directory. */
static void
LADSPADirectoryPluginSearch (const char * pcDirectory,
LADSPAPluginSearchCallbackFunction fCallbackFunction,
void* user_data)
{
char * pcFilename;
DIR * psDirectory;
LADSPA_Descriptor_Function fDescriptorFunction;
long lDirLength;
long iNeedSlash;
struct dirent * psDirectoryEntry;
void * pvPluginHandle;
lDirLength = strlen(pcDirectory);
if (!lDirLength)
return;
if (pcDirectory[lDirLength - 1] == '/')
iNeedSlash = 0;
else
iNeedSlash = 1;
psDirectory = opendir(pcDirectory);
if (!psDirectory)
return;
while (1) {
psDirectoryEntry = readdir(psDirectory);
if (!psDirectoryEntry) {
closedir(psDirectory);
return;
}
pcFilename = malloc(lDirLength
+ strlen(psDirectoryEntry->d_name)
+ 1 + iNeedSlash);
strcpy(pcFilename, pcDirectory);
if (iNeedSlash)
strcat(pcFilename, "/");
strcat(pcFilename, psDirectoryEntry->d_name);
pvPluginHandle = dlopen(pcFilename, RTLD_LAZY);
if (pvPluginHandle) {
/* This is a file and the file is a shared library! */
dlerror();
fDescriptorFunction
= (LADSPA_Descriptor_Function)dlsym(pvPluginHandle,
"ladspa_descriptor");
if (dlerror() == NULL && fDescriptorFunction) {
/* We've successfully found a ladspa_descriptor function. Pass
it to the callback function. */
fCallbackFunction(pcFilename,
pvPluginHandle,
fDescriptorFunction,
user_data);
dlclose (pvPluginHandle);
}
else {
/* It was a library, but not a LADSPA one. Unload it. */
dlclose(pcFilename);
}
}
}
}
/*****************************************************************************/
void
LADSPAPluginSearch(LADSPAPluginSearchCallbackFunction fCallbackFunction,
void* user_data)
{
char * pcBuffer;
const char * pcEnd;
const char * pcLADSPAPath;
const char * pcStart;
pcLADSPAPath = getenv("LADSPA_PATH");
if (!pcLADSPAPath) {
//fprintf(stderr, "Warning: no LADSPA_PATH, assuming /usr/lib/ladspa:/usr/local/lib/ladspa\n");
#ifdef __APPLE__
pcLADSPAPath = "/sw/lib/ladspa:/usr/local/lib/ladspa";
#else
pcLADSPAPath = "/usr/lib/ladspa:/usr/local/lib/ladspa";
#endif
}
pcStart = pcLADSPAPath;
while (*pcStart != '\0') {
pcEnd = pcStart;
while (*pcEnd != ':' && *pcEnd != '\0')
pcEnd++;
pcBuffer = malloc(1 + pcEnd - pcStart);
if (pcEnd > pcStart)
strncpy(pcBuffer, pcStart, pcEnd - pcStart);
pcBuffer[pcEnd - pcStart] = '\0';
LADSPADirectoryPluginSearch(pcBuffer, fCallbackFunction, user_data);
pcStart = pcEnd;
if (*pcStart == ':')
pcStart++;
}
}
/*****************************************************************************/
/* EOF */
